Output 81af88d87f8aa064a9e21ccece6a36fd26a9f04e8de717dfde819219ae1384ec:191

value
512843
script pubkey
OP_0 OP_PUSHBYTES_20 1d8ec0930cc349d0bd6f524840892cf97483eeef
address
bc1qrk8vpycvcdyap0t02fyypzfvl96g8mh0jzvfml
transaction
81af88d87f8aa064a9e21ccece6a36fd26a9f04e8de717dfde819219ae1384ec
spent
true